Beyond the Finish Mark: Creative Distance Award Designs
The standard round endurance medal has long been the norm , but increasingly runners are looking for something distinctive to commemorate their feat. Innovative designs are surfacing, spanning from intricate sculpted pieces depicting competition landmarks to bespoke medals incorporating runner 's names or concluding times. Some creators are even trying with non-traditional materials, including wood, ceramic , or even reused metals, to create truly unique keepsakes that stretch far after the preliminary thrill of crossing the finish line . This shift ensures that each medal becomes more than just an thing; it’s a representation of dedication and enduring remembrance.
Collecting Marathon Medals: A Passionate Pursuit
For many athletes , completing a marathon is a impressive achievement, and the award earned serves as a tangible symbol of that effort . Collecting these shiny tokens has blossomed into a fervent hobby for a growing following of enthusiasts. Some commence with medals from their local events , while others actively pursue the prestige of completing international marathons across the planet, creating a special collection that tells a story of perseverance and a passion for the sport.
